M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015 – 396 Pages.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
that
discusses
topics
relating to open
educational res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ses.
The latest
improvements in
online education technology have empowered
people
in nations all around the world
to be participants in classes via the Internet.
These massively open online courses are
almost always free
for learners but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
There are quite a few
issues that
distance learning organizations
are having to consider
today because online education technology is
improving so rapidly.
This collected edition describes many different types of MOOC options and the full range of business plans related to MOOCs.
